Police are investigating a serious sexual assault on a teenage girl in Great Ryburgh on Sunday (28 February).

It happened between approximately 2pm and 4pm in an area of rail track off Mill Lane.

Officers are appealing for anyone who witnessed the incident or was in the area during the times stated to come forward. They are particularly keen to speak with dog walkers or horse riders who were seen in the area at the time.

Anyone with information should contact Swaffham CID on 101 quoting crime reference number 36/13082/21.
